Transaction e91d3fd5925ed48546400c8651fe0751e9a16a09504b1cf6f57deabfbada72fb
1 Input
1 Output
-
e91d3fd5925ed48546400c8651fe0751e9a16a09504b1cf6f57deabfbada72fb:0
- value
- 509427
- script pubkey
- OP_0 OP_PUSHBYTES_20 d527b7c07b74ed23d524ba109c691d313ce4160e
- address
- bc1q65nm0srmwnkj84fyhggfc6gaxy7wg9swt0uj0f